WoRMS taxon details
Buccinum rossicum Dall, 1907
490846 (urn:lsid:marinespecies.org:taxname:490846)
accepted
Species
marine, brackish, fresh, terrestrial
Dall, W.H. (1907). Descriptions of new species of shells, chiefly Buccinidae, from the dredgings of the U.S.S. "Albatross" during 1906, in the northwestern Pacific, Bering, Okhotsk, and Japanese Seas. <em>Smithsonian Miscellaneous Collections.</em> 50(2): 139-173., available online at https://www.biodiversitylibrary.org/page/30049029
page(s): 150 [details]
page(s): 150 [details]
Note Aniwa Bay, southern Sakhalin, in 42 fathoms,...
Type locality Aniwa Bay, southern Sakhalin, in 42 fathoms, and Tsugaru Strait, north Japan, in 300 fathoms [details]
